Transaction 14d1c82ef1d418b7f2873ba50faa2251e245c14bd9e44878bf8ea4637e059bfd

150 Input
1 Outputs
  • 14d1c82ef1d418b7f2873ba50faa2251e245c14bd9e44878bf8ea4637e059bfd:0
  • value  17567469211
    address  1AgqwqfYYiufntjB4C8Q8xmfTCk7ce2vZh